About

Gláucia Braggion is a scholar working on Physiology, Education and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Gláucia Braggion has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 807 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Physiology, 6 papers in Education and 4 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. Recurrent topics in Gláucia Braggion’s work include Physical Education and Gymnastics (6 papers), Physical Activity and Health (5 papers) and Youth, Drugs, and Violence (4 papers). Gláucia Braggion is often cited by papers focused on Physical Education and Gymnastics (6 papers), Physical Activity and Health (5 papers) and Youth, Drugs, and Violence (4 papers). Gláucia Braggion collaborates with scholars based in Brazil and United States. Gláucia Braggion's co-authors include Sandra Mahecha Matsudo, Victor Keihan Rodrigues Matsudo, Erinaldo Andrade, Douglas Roque Andrade, Timóteo Leandro Araújo, Luís C. Oliveira, Fernando Luiz Affonso Fonseca, Laura Beatriz Mesiano Maifrino, Vagner Raso and Gláucia Luciano da Veiga and has published in prestigious journals such as Medicine & Science in Sports & Exercise, Oxidative Medicine and Cellular Longevity and Public Health Nutrition.
